Born by the most mighty sorcerers of their realm, Melody loses her family’s magical powers when her parents’ marriage collapses, transforming her into the sharp, resentful girl—skeptical of love and fiercely independent.
Determined to restore her child’’s gift, her mother, the Mires Queen, turns to dark magic and enacts an ancient ritual: Melody must marry a human and sacrifice him to reclaim her powers. To help her, she summons the Wonder Beast, a mythical shapeshifter capable of becoming any animal, bird, or even the perfect Prince Charming. Yet as the story unfolds, the Wonder Beast begins to enjoy life as a human, discovering emotions and desires he was never meant to feel.
Melody’s father, Blackspire, ruler of the mountains, refuses to accept the idea of his daughter bound to a human. To control her destiny, he sets cunning trials and attracts formidable suitors with enchanted artifacts—a fearless knight and an immortal vampire—each eager to win Melody’s hand. Facing treacherous marshes, labyrinthine forests, and towering, desolate peaks, Melody and the Wonder Beast are swept into daring escapades, magical duels, and unforeseen perils that test courage, wit, and the limits of their hearts. In the end, Melody must face a difficult choice between regaining power through sacrifice or embracing feelings that cannot be commanded. Against a backdrop of spells and monsters, the movie unveils a timeless truth: true love is the greatest magic of all.
